Geisinger neurosurgeons provide the full spectrum of state-of-the-art treatments of brain, spinal and peripheral neurosurgical problems. Minimally invasive surgery techniques can often eliminate the need to perform traditional surgery.
Using the latest endovascular, computerguided, endoscopic, stereotactic and percutaneous techniques, Geisinger neurosurgeons provide safe and effective treatments for many conditions thought to be inoperable just a few years ago.
Brain & Spinal Tumor Surgery
Geisinger neurosurgeons treat benign and malignant brain and spinal cord tumors using the latest endoscopic and computerassisted stereotactic techniques.
Cerebrovascular & Endovascular Neurosurgery
Endovascular therapies allow neurosurgeons to treat brain aneurysms, blood vessel malformations, carotid stenosis and other forms of strokes through a needle stick in the groin artery. For more complex vascular problems, skullbased surgery with profound hypothermia and circulation arrest is available.
Cranial Base Surgery
Geisinger neurosurgeons partner with other Geisinger craniofacial surgeons to treat tumors, vascular disorders and injuries of the cranial base. Epilepsy & Movement Disorders - For patients with medically intractable epilepsy or movement disorders, our neurosurgeons use the latest restorative, regulatory or ablative surgical procedures to improve patient functionality.
Pediatric Neurosurgery
Geisinger neurosurgeons provide surgical services to patients of all ages, including premature infants. In addition to acquired and traumatic neurosurgical conditions, our neurosurgeons provide corrective therapy for a wide range of congenital conditions.
Spine Surgery
Geisinger neurosurgeons provide surgical treatment for degenerative, neoplastic, traumatic and congenital spinal disorders. A wide range of surgical procedures, including percutaneous procedures, decompressive surgery, reconstructive surgery with instrumentation and fusion and functional spinal neurosurgery, is available.
Neurosurgical oncology
Geisinger neurosurgeons perform more than 120 successful central nervous system tumor operations each year. Hundreds of patients with brain or spinal cord lesions are cared for each year throughout Geisinger Health System. Our highly experienced neurosurgeons successfully treat patients with the following types of tumors: intrinsic brain tumors (gliomas), metastatic tumors, meningiomas, pituitary tumors, acoustic neuromas, skull base tumors, pediatric brain tumors, pineal region tumors, suprasellar tumors, intra-ventricular tumors, intrinsic spinal cord tumors, compressive tumors of the spinal cord, and recurrent tumors.
Operations have been aided by state-of-the-art facilities such as frameless and framed stereotactic equipment, intra-operative ultrasound, ultrasonic aspirator, lasers, endovascular therapy, chemotherapeutic wafter implants, radiation implants, gamma knife radiosurgery, microscopic surgery, minimally invasive endoscopic surgery, evoked potential monitoring, eloquent tissue mapping, invasive monitoring, awake craniotomy, PET scanning, functional MRI and MRI spectroscopy. Both GMC and GWV are supported by medical and radiation oncology teams; neurosurgical physician assistants; speech, physical, and occupational therapy teams; nutritionalists; rehabilitation specialists; neuroradiologists; intensive care specialists; neurologists; neurootologists; skull base otolaryngologists; social services, and pain control specialists to provide complete patient care.
